Study Description

Brief Summary

The investigators are looking for volunteers who have a history of Major Depressive Disorder, the Winter Blues, or Seasonal Affective Disorder or healthy volunteers who do not have a history of these disorders for a research study on genetics.

Condition or Disease Intervention/Treatment Phase

    Detailed Description

    The investigators are looking for volunteers who have a history of Major Depressive Disorder, the Winter Blues, or Seasonal Affective Disorder or healthy volunteers who do not have a history of these disorders for a research study on genetics. Participation involves one 2-3 hour visit involving two diagnostic interviews, DNA collection, and questionnaires.

    Arms and Interventions

    Arm Intervention/Treatment
    Seasonal Affective Disorder

    Consists of Individuals with Seasonal Affective Disorder

    Subsyndromal Seasonal Affective Disorder

    Consists of individuals who do not meet SAD criteria,but present more symptoms for the disorder than do controls.

    Major Depressive Disorder

    Consists of individuals who have MDD.

    Controls

    Consists of individuals who do not present symptoms of SAD or MDD.
